Registry Search and Replace
To switch to this mode, click the Search and Replace button on the Modes bar in the left part of the main window of Reg Organizer.

In this mode you can find and replace specific information in the registry.

Set up all required search (or replace) parameters and click Search to start the search.

You can use profiles to save the search (and replace) settings. Use the Profiles tab to save the current profile to a file or load a previously saved one.

All the instances of the search text will appear in the Results tab. You can edit or delete the found records. To edit a record, select it in the table and click the Change button to bring up the editor window. Enter the new value name (leave the corresponding field empty if you don't want to modify it) and value data. Click OK to apply changes.

The Delete button has additional options (you can view them by clicking the drop-down arrow next to the button). Use these options to specify whether the selected record must be removed from the registry or from the search results only. Clicking the button removes the record from the Registry and from the search results list. You can also remove a record only from the search results list by marking it and pressing the Del key.
